The measure of an exterior angle of triangle is equal to the sum of measures of two interior angles of triangle that are not supplementary with this exterior angles.
In the case of this question this fact sounds as
m∠XBC = m∠BAC + m∠BCA (option 1).
Now if
- m∠XBC=(3p-6)°
- m∠BAC=(p+4)°
- m∠BCA=84°,
then
3p-6=p+4+84 (option 2),
3p-6=p+88 (option 3),
3p-p-6=p-p+88,
2p-6=88 (option 4),
2p-6+6=88+6,
2p=94 (option 5),
p=47.
Then m∠XBC=(3p-6)°=(3·47-6)°=135°.
Answer: m∠XBC=135°.

A ratio can be written in three different ways: 3 to 4, 3:4, and 3/4
What does this mean? It means that for every group of 7 students (3+4) there are 3 boys and 4 girls. And how many groups do we have? We have:
245/7= 35 We have 35 groups, and we just said that each group has 3 boys and 4 girls:
35*3= 105 boys
35*4= 140 girls
